第5周项目4:长方柱类

来源:互联网 发布:万方—中国机构数据库 编辑:程序博客网 时间:2024/05/20 23:39
/* * Copyright(c)2016,烟台大学计算机与控制工程学院 * All rights reserved. * 文件名称:第5周项目4:长方柱类 * 作者:于子娴 * 完成日期:2016.3.30 * 版本号:v1.0 * * 问题描述:编写基于对象的程序,求3个长方柱(Bulk)的体积。数据成员包括长(length)、宽(width)、高(heigth)、体积,要求设计成员函数实现下面的功能:       (1)由键盘输入3个长方柱的长、宽、高。       (2)计算长方柱的体积(volume)和表面积(area);       (3)输出这3个长方柱的体积和表面积。 * 输入描述:3个长方柱的长、宽、高。 * 程序输出:这3个长方柱的体积和表面积。 */#include<iostream>using namespace std;class Bulk{public:    void get();    void show();private:    float lengh;    float width;    float height;};void Bulk::get(){    cout<<"please input lengh, width,height:";    cin>>lengh;    cin>>width;    cin>>height;}void Bulk::show(){    cout<<"The volume is: "<<lengh*width*height<<endl;    cout<<"The surface area is: "<<2*(lengh*width+lengh*height+width*height)<<endl;}int main(){    Bulk b1,b2,b3;    b1.get();    cout<<"Bulk1: "<<endl;    b1.show();    b2.get();    cout<<"Bulk2: "<<endl;    b2.show();    b3.get();    cout<<"Bulk3: "<<endl;    b3.show();    return 0;}

运行结果:


0 0
原创粉丝点击